you can tell by the front grilles,
if its a slatted grille D8
if its a Honeycombe grille big puggy badged its d9
you can also tell off the rear lights,
if its got a colour coded strip in the middle of the lights its d9
d8s dont have that,

Depends on your definition of a D8.5 I guesstrem1 wrote:dont forget about the d8.5, not many about but they are there,somewhere
Some say, it's the D9 rear end and a D8 front end
Personally I think it's any car that incorporates parts associated with both cars
The HDi engine was thought at one time to be D9 specific, but was in fact brought in Oct 98, 6 months before the D9
Thus we "could" say any HDi equipped D8 is a D8.5
My car for example, has the exterior of the D8, with the HDi engine, and the dashboard carcass of the D9, the D9 wing mirrors, and the D9 sunblind
Thus i'd class it as a D8.5
